Ahead of any official announcement, we have learned that Walt Disney Studios Home Entertainment will be releasing the hotly anticipated follow-up to Pixar Short Films Collection Volume 1, Volume 2, available to own on November 13, 2012 and now available for pre-order from Amazon.com.
Details are sparse at the moment, but shorts are expected to include La Luna, Dug’s Special Mission, Toy Story Toon: Hawaiian Vacation, Partly Cloudy, Presto and Day & Night.
In addition, the collection will contain extras that delve into how much of Pixar’s talent got their start and even includes student films from acclaimed directors Pete Docter, Andrew Stanton and John Lasseter including Nitemare, The Lady and the Lamp, Somewhere In The Arctic, A Story, Winter, Palm Springs and Next Door.
